Vibration Analysis

The Predictive Advantage

By the time an operator can hear a bearing grinding or feel a motor vibrating excessively, the component is already in the final stages of failure. Vibration analysis allows maintenance teams to detect microscopic wear months before catastrophic failure occurs.

The Frequency Spectrum (FFT)

Overall vibration tells you that a machine is sick; the Fast Fourier Transform (FFT) spectrum tells you why. By breaking down the complex vibration waveform into individual frequencies, analysts can pinpoint specific faults.

For example, if a motor runs at 1800 RPM (30 Hz), a high peak at exactly 30 Hz (1X running speed) strongly suggests unbalance. A high peak at 60 Hz (2X running speed) usually points to misalignment.
